// Rationale: higher levels improve bandwidth ~8% on Fernwhistle
// telemetry frames but widen the compression-oracle surface when
// attacker-controlled data shares a context with session markers.
// We also disable context takeover per connection to bound memory
// and limit cross-message leakage. Do not raise this value without
// re-running the oracle test battery in the Hollowgate suite.
// The last battery that cleared this constant is tagged with the
// build token below.

session token of bawep-yadup = htk21_528abd376e3c5a4ec24a1

## Authentication

The Farepost rules engine evaluates shipping-fee rules via the /evaluate endpoint. All requests require a bearer token scoped to your contractor role; read-only scopes can fetch rule sets but cannot publish changes. Tokens expire after 12 hours and are rotated by the Quillhaven identity service, so do not cache them in source or config files. For local development against the sandbox tier, export the token as an environment variable before running the test suite. Use the bearer token below.

session JWT of yawep-yawep = eyJhbGciOiJIUzI1NiIsInR5cCI6IkpXVCJ9.eyJzdWIiOiI3pWF3_In0.aXYsHiog

Handover — Bramblet kiosk fleet

Watchdog on the Ferroway terminals is flapping; I disabled auto-restart on kiosk group C to stop the reboot loop. Fix lands tomorrow. If the watchdog locks the maintenance console overnight, you'll need to unlock it manually. Use the recovery passphrase given immediately below.

strongbox words: praath-queniel-holax-druael-jorath-noveth-druok

## Q3 Planning Note — Franchise Agreement, Marlowe Provisions

The franchise agreement with the Ostergard Group is finalized for twelve territories. Royalty structure follows the standard schedule; training obligations begin next quarter. Initial fees cover onboarding costs with modest margin. The board should note one contingency affecting timing, detailed in the confidential note below.

confidential, bagap-kahog: Only 9 of the 80 pilot accounts renewed Oliath, so a churn review is set for April 15.